Output 85681a0f8778f3c791e74f8abeaf613bf0e2859bd496acc1a02d6afddd11e672:1

value
21297624
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5cc391931306d8381e034dbc25d4e68a341c0157 OP_EQUAL
address
3A9WNYHVtpL3x7T2k6PWSBexbUxLvRnAC7
transaction
85681a0f8778f3c791e74f8abeaf613bf0e2859bd496acc1a02d6afddd11e672
spent
true